So there are a few things here that you need to be made aware of. First, Ace Performance Systems is the New England region Ariel Atom dealer and they are located in Tewksbury, Massachusetts. They suffered through the same horrific winter I did and we’re all a little nutso about it at this point. Secondly, the people at Ace thought it would be a good idea to drag race one of their full race Atoms against a snowmobile. Third, the location this is filmed on is unique and weird in and of itself because Alton, NH is home to the only FAA approved ice runway in the lower 48-states. I’ve actually been there when planes were coming in and out and it rules. It did not rule as hard as when an Ariel Atom freaking drag raced a snowmobile but it was neat all the same.

The snowmobile here is a 2015 Polaris 800cc unit with a capable enough looking rider and no other mentioned modifications. It makes 160hp and weighs in at a svelte 460lbs. The Atom is the full race version so it is packing a 230hp Honda four banger and it tips the scales at 1,315lbs. The one modification made to the Atom was the addition of some Woody’s screw in studs to help give the light car some more grip on the slippery surface.

We’ve always wanted to spend a couple minutes behind the wheel of an Ariel Atom because who wouldn’t? The thing is the basic essence of a hot rod, just like the guys on the lakes used to strip windshields, fenders, and hoods off of their cars, so the Atom has shed every possible ounce of “unnecessary” weight.

You can snicker at the 230hp number all you want but in just 1,315lbs the thing likely corners hard enough to shift your organs and it should (depending on traction) have enough guts to give the Polaris a run for its money here on the icy track. Now…do you think they pulled it off?
